Imagetek Salary

As of August 2026, the average hourly salary for employees at Imagetek in the United States is $37. This translates to an approximate annual wage of $76,483. Salaries at Imagetek typically range from $32 to $42 hourly,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Huntsville?

Understanding the cost of living near Huntsville is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Imagetek.
Huntsville's Cost of Living Index is approximately 85.9 (14.1% less expensive than US average; 4.4% more than AL average). Higher cost within AL due to stronger housing demand (tech hub). When planning your budget based on a salary from Imagetek, consider these typical monthly expenses:

FAQ 5: Why might an individual's actual salary at Imagetek differ from the ranges shown here?
An individual's actual salary at Imagetek can differ from our estimated ranges due to various factors. These include their specific years of experience in the role, unique skills or certifications, educational background, performance record, the specific team or department they join, negotiation outcomes, and even the precise timing of when they were hired relative to market fluctuations. Our ranges represent typical compensation.
